Hi all,

in a layer I'm using I noticed that some recipes used the default
generic architecture although they (build) depend on machine specific
recipes. As far as understand this is generally incorrect, a recipe
should never have a build dependency that has a more specific
architecture than the recipe itself.

Assuming this is correct would it be possible to have a QA check to
verify this? I gave it a shot but didn't found how I could get the
architecture of other recipes, any pointer on how that could be
realised?
